Matilde Saavedra and Courtney Louisville in Two-Vehicle Crash on 5 Freeway near State Route 166

 
Bakersfield, CA (August 17, 2020) – A two-vehicle crash involving a pickup truck on Interstate 5 killed 56-year-old Matilde Saavedra and 15-year-old Courtney Louisville.
 
Moreover, the California Highway Patrol responded to the crash on August 16 on Interstate 5 just north of State Route 166.
 
Subsequently, the fatal collision involved a Ford F-150 and a Honda SUV. According to CHP, the pickup truck was traveling southbound on Interstate 5 and veered off to avoid debris in the fast lane.
 
However, the truck driver lost control of the vehicle and continued on the westbound lanes before crashing into a northbound Honda SUV and another semi-truck.
 
As a result, the SUV rolled over and went off the right side of the road, then into an orchard. The impact of the collision seriously hurt three occupants of the SUV and emergency responders took them to the hospital. One of them suffered major injuries, according to the report.
 
Furthermore, the truck driver also sustained minor injuries and was taken to the hospital for treatments.

Pending Investigation of Bakersfield Multi-Car Crash

 
Based on the investigation, CHP Sgt. Basil Zuniga said that neither alcohol nor drugs were believed to be a factor in the incident.
 
The Highway 99 transition on Interstate 5 was closed but has since reopened.
